Ай Ти Гэлакси 

Киров

Сферы деятельности

Информационные технологии, системная интеграция, интернет

Я хочу тут работать
×

Ай Ти Гэлакси 

Обязанности:
Разработка клиентской части web-приложений.
Поддержка и рефакторинг существующего Front-end кода.

Требования:
Опыт кроссбраузерной валидной семантической (html5, microdata, microformats) адаптивной вёрстки (примеры работ или ссылки на проекты в github, bitbucket, gitlab и т.д.).
Чувство юзабилити.
Уверенная работа с PSD-макетами.
Уверенное знание и понимание HTML5, CSS (SASS/SCSS).
Знание и опыт работы с Bootstrap (версии 3), плюсом будет знание 4 версии.
Опыт программирования на JavaScript (ECMA5+), node.js.
Владение jQuery, опыт использования jQuery-плагинов.
Опыт программирования на PHP.
Опыт программирования и понимание WordPress архитектуры, плагинов и тем.
Понимание принципов работы клиент-серверной архитектуры.
Знание английского языка (чтение документации и профессиональной литературы).
Умение работать с системой контроля версий Git.
Ответственность.
Опыт работы в команде, работа с чужим кодом.
Работа в Битрикс24.

Плюсом будет:
Желание познавать новое, решать интересные задачи и развиваться в области программирования.
Опыт программирования на других языках, понимание ООП, MVC, MVVM и т.п.
Профиль на GitHub (или/и других сервисах для совместной работы над проектов), Habrahabr и т.п.
Использование MacOS или Linux based OS в качестве основной ОС.
Участие в Open Source проектах.
Опыт работы с системами сборки проектов (webpack, gulp, grunt).
Опыт программирования с использованием современных PHP фреймворков (symfony, laravel, yii).
Опыт работы с современными Javascript фреймворками (express, react, sailsjs), особым плюсом будет владение React + Redux.
Опыт работы с пакетными менеджерами (PHP - composer, Node.js - npm, yarn).
Опыт работы с PostCSS, умение писать плагины.
Знание и понимание реляционных баз данных (MySQL, Percona, PostgreSQL и т.п.).
Умение покрывать свой код тестами (PHP - phpunit, Javascript - ava, mocha, tape, jest и т.п.).
Базовые знания технологий взаимодействие с сервером Ajax, REST, Comet, WebSocket.
Использование статических анализаторов для выявления ошибок и стандартизации кода (eslint, stylelint, phpcs и т.п.).
Опыт работы в GitLab.
Работа в современных редакторах кода - Atom, Intellij Idea, Sublime text.
Понимание принципов обработки веб-страниц поисковыми роботами (заголовки, описания, robots.txt и т.п.).